The Long, Painful "March" To 755
We're not gonna make any predictions this time — and we promise, this is the last time we're gonna end a day with a Bonds post — but Barry Bonds might or might not give this another try tonight.
It has been amusing to watch how different people react to this drawn-out business. Particularly, Bud Selig, who gave a rather ridiculous press conference yesterday in which he claimed following Bonds around was "a Herculean effort" and that people "are stunned that I'm still doing this." (ESPN's Bomani Jones has an outstanding deconstruction of Selig's lunacy.) We think this chase is making Selig lose his mind. We understand where he's coming from.
Meanwhile, the nation's sushi makers are having a grand time with this. At least somebody is.
